Access Control Card
An Access Control Card is an electronic device that grants access to restricted areas or resources. It typically utilizes a unique identification number or code stored within the card to authenticate users. These cards can be read by readers installed at entry points, allowing authorized individuals to enter secure locations. They offer a convenient and secure method for managing access control in various settings, including buildings, facilities, computer systems, and networks.
- Types of Access Control Cards include RFID cards, magnetic stripe cards, and biometric cards.
- Access Control Cards strengthen security by limiting access to authorized personnel only.
- They can also be integrated with other systems, such as time clocks and alarm systems, for comprehensive security management.
